WebCommission Regulation (EC) No 2273/2003 of 22 December 2003 implementing Directive 2003/6/ EC of the European Parliament and of the Council as regards exemptions for … WebApr 6, 2024 · Getting a SIM card in Bulgaria is pretty straightforward and affordable. I recommend not buying one at the airport, but instead, head to one of these shops: A1, Yettel, or Vivacom. You can get a top-up plan for less than 10 euros a month.
